F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

What is The Tenant about?
A quiet and inconspicuous man rents an apartment in Paris where he finds himself drawn into a rabbit hole of dangerous paranoia.
How long is The Tenant?
The Tenant has a runtime of 126 minutes (2h 6m).
Who stars in The Tenant?
The cast of The Tenant includes Roman Polanski, Isabelle Adjani, Melvyn Douglas, Jo Van Fleet, Bernard Fresson.
How much did The Tenant make at the box office?
The Tenant earned $5,100,000 worldwide at the box office.
What is the rating of The Tenant?
The Tenant has a rating of 7.6 out of 10 based on 1,209 votes on TMDB.
